mm/slub: Add Support for free path information of an object



This commit adds enables a stack dump for the last free of an object:

slab kmalloc-64 start c8ab0140 data offset 64 pointer offset 0 size 64 allocated at meminfo_proc_show+0x40/0x4fc
[   20.192078]     meminfo_proc_show+0x40/0x4fc
[   20.192263]     seq_read_iter+0x18c/0x4c4
[   20.192430]     proc_reg_read_iter+0x84/0xac
[   20.192617]     generic_file_splice_read+0xe8/0x17c
[   20.192816]     splice_direct_to_actor+0xb8/0x290
[   20.193008]     do_splice_direct+0xa0/0xe0
[   20.193185]     do_sendfile+0x2d0/0x438
[   20.193345]     sys_sendfile64+0x12c/0x140
[   20.193523]     ret_fast_syscall+0x0/0x58
[   20.193695]     0xbeeacde4
[   20.193822]  Free path:
[   20.193935]     meminfo_proc_show+0x5c/0x4fc
[   20.194115]     seq_read_iter+0x18c/0x4c4
[   20.194285]     proc_reg_read_iter+0x84/0xac
[   20.194475]     generic_file_splice_read+0xe8/0x17c
[   20.194685]     splice_direct_to_actor+0xb8/0x290
[   20.194870]     do_splice_direct+0xa0/0xe0
[   20.195014]     do_sendfile+0x2d0/0x438
[   20.195174]     sys_sendfile64+0x12c/0x140
[   20.195336]     ret_fast_syscall+0x0/0x58
[   20.195491]     0xbeeacde4
